Transaction e4bcab2e93261a79a891573b82078b64d1846e037c3af50c931d550479b723f7
1 Input
1 Output
-
e4bcab2e93261a79a891573b82078b64d1846e037c3af50c931d550479b723f7:0
- value
- 659653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eced978947ab384823d00f87b291daf537338911 OP_EQUAL
- address
- 3PHn1zYnw99DEMCqd8qd8NjuBEkbJXR6e4